One thing is clear: Circularity can only be achieved through collaboration. Together with our customer @Orbhes Espumas e Colchões Ltda, we're proud to announce the launch of the first mattress using our renewable-certified PU foam attributed via mass balance. By incorporating our Desmodur® CQ T80 MB, an ISCC* PLUS-certified toluene diisocyanate (TDI) extracted from palm oil, into the foam production of its high-end Stallion and Restonic portfolio, Orbhes is offering a more sustainable alternative to conventional mattresses, setting a new benchmark for the industry in Brazil. Covestro zählt zu den weltweit führenden Herstellern von hochwertigen Kunststoffen und deren Komponenten. Mit seinen innovativen Produkten und Verfahren trägt das Unternehmen zu mehr Nachhaltigkeit und Lebensqualität auf vielen Gebieten bei. Covestro beliefert rund um den Globus Kunden in Schlüsselindustrien wie Mobilität, Bauen und Wohnen sowie Elektro und Elektronik. Außerdem werden die Polymere von Covestro in Bereichen wie Sport und Freizeit, Telekommunikation, Gesundheit sowie in der Chemieindustrie selbst eingesetzt. Das Unternehmen richtet sich vollständig auf die Kreislaufwirtschaft aus. Zudem will Covestro bis 2035 Klimaneutralität für seine Scope-1- und Scope-2-Emissionen erreichen, bis 2050 sollen auch die Scope-3-Emissionen des Konzerns klimaneutral sein. Im Geschäftsjahr 2024 erzielte Covestro einen Umsatz von 14,2 Milliarden Euro. Per Ende 2024 produziert das Unternehmen an 46 Standorten weltweit und beschäftigt rund 17.500 Mitarbeitende (umgerechnet auf Vollzeitstellen). 🎉 We've extended the contract with our CTO Dr. Thorsten Dreier ahead of schedule! 🎉 He will remain Chief Technology Officer for a further five years. The Supervisory Board has extended his contract, which runs until June 2026, ahead of schedule from July 1, 2026 to June 30, 2031. Thorsten Dreier is Chief Technology Officer and Member of the Board of Management since July 2023 and Labor Director since September 2023. In his role as CTO, Thorsten Dreier is responsible for the corporate functions Engineering, Process Technology, Group Health, Safety, Environment & Reliability and Group Procurement as well as the reporting segment of Performance Materials. 👉 More info: https://lnkd.in/ej_A8Mj5

The EU Commission presents an “Action Plan” for the chemical industry and puts #resilience front and center. Why I see this as one of Ursula von der Leyen‘s most decisive moves yet and why we mustn’t stop there. 👇 The so called "Critical Chemical Alliance" aims to address what keeps us awake at night. In a world where geopolitical tensions, protectionism and supply chain disruptions have become our reality, this new body can protect Europe's critical chemical production sites - and maintain Europe's strategic autonomy. The comprehensive thought behind the alliance seems promising. It focuses on protecting capacity and modernizing investments while coordinating across EU member states and tackling trade challenges. If implemented, it can move Europe from analysis to action - finally. And there's more: The "Action Plan" fosters affordable energy, drives innovation with new fiscal incentives, simplifies and reduces regulation, and takes a reasonable, science-based approach to PFAS. I particularly appreciate that Ursula von der Leyen is pushing this package forward at unprecedented speed. Because: timing is everything. With mounting global pressures, we must implement these measures swiftly and pragmatically. The chemical industry stands ready to turn her vision into reality.
